“Sarah Ferguson Considers Portugal Move Amid Epstein Scandal”

Sarah Ferguson, who has faced disgrace, is rumored to be considering leaving the UK amidst the ongoing Jeffrey Epstein scandal. Allegedly, she is looking at a guest suite in a luxurious oceanfront villa in Portugal owned by her daughter Princess Eugenie and son-in-law Jack Brooksbank. This potential move coincides with her and ex-husband Andrew Mountbatten Windsor’s upcoming departure from their long-held Royal Lodge residence.

The decision for Fergie and Andrew to leave the prestigious estate comes amid continued controversy surrounding their ties to the late convicted child sex trafficker Epstein. Despite assertions of innocence from Andrew regarding any involvement in Epstein’s illicit activities, the couple has been compelled to relocate.

Following the surfacing of a 2011 email where Fergie referred to Epstein as her “supreme friend” after his conviction for child sex offenses, she faced repercussions, including removal from various charitable organizations. The email also hinted at an apology from Fergie to Epstein for her previous public criticisms, contrasting with her earlier denunciation of him as a grave error in judgment.

While Fergie claimed to sever ties with Epstein, subsequent messages revealed a humble apology to him, with her spokesperson later clarifying that the email was sent in response to potential legal threats from Epstein. Amid the fallout from the Epstein revelations, reports suggest that Fergie is on the brink of a breakdown, with her sister Jane flying in from Australia to offer support.

The impending departure of Fergie and Andrew from the Royal Lodge marks the conclusion of their extended cohabitation, despite their divorce in 1996. Andrew is anticipated to relocate to the Sandringham estate following the renunciation of his titles by his brother King Charles.
